コメント |
@DIV
using System;
// ********************************************************
// * 実行
// ********************************************************
public class App
{
public static void Main() {
// ****************************************
// 未初期化の文字列型はエラー
// データをセットする必要がある
// ****************************************
String str;
str = "ABC";
Console.WriteLine(str);
// ****************************************
// 初期化された文字列型
// ****************************************
String str1 = "XYZ";
Console.WriteLine(str1);
// ****************************************
// コンストラクタによる初期化
// ****************************************
char[] ch2 = new char[] {'A','B'};
String str2 = new String(ch2);
Console.WriteLine(str2);
// ****************************************
// 配列を new で初期化
// ****************************************
String[] str3 = new String[] {"ABC","XYZ"};
Console.WriteLine(str3);
Console.WriteLine(String.Join(",",str3));
// ****************************************
// 上記短縮形
// ****************************************
String[] str4 = {"ABC","XYZ"};
Console.WriteLine(str4);
Console.WriteLine(String.Join(",",str4));
// ****************************************
// 要素数を指定して、空で初期化
// ****************************************
String[] str5 = new String[3];
Console.WriteLine(str5);
Console.WriteLine(String.Join(",",str5));
}
}
@END
|